Heavy Bleeding, Blood Clots, Continuous Spotting. Taken Levofloxacin, M2 Tone Tablets And Primolut. Explain Reason
I am 48, my periods started on 10th July and have been heavy with a lot of clots, they went on for 2 weeks so I took M2 Tone tablets which did not help much, they continued but were light, then I took primolut which stopped them but continued spotting, I am now taking sylate but I am still spotting and sometimes I bleed when I go for a short call, I though may be I have an infection so my pharmacist prescribed levoflaxin for 5 days which I am taking together with sylate, I am on my 4th day I am still spotting and have started experiecing lower abdominal cramps from yesterday. Please help me.
hi thanks for your query you have Heavy bleeding, blood clots, continuous spotting. at your age it is very serious condition. causes of excessive bleeding -fibroid uterus -endometrial hyperplasia -endometrial carcinoma
these are the causes which should be ruled out. have some investigations for early diagnosis and treatment. -sonography of uterus for size, shape,and endometrial thichness. -blood coagulation profile -endometrial biopsy have all these tests and decide according to their result. if any query you can ask.
